В сентябре на базе Воронежского государственного университета был запущен новый образовательный проект Mail.Ru Group «Игросфера Воронеж». Для студентов открылись два семестровых курса в формате бесплатного дополнительного образования: «Разработка игр на Unity» и «Тестирование игровых проектов».

Роман Гуров, преподаватель «Игросферы» и QA-директор студии «Аллоды», рассказывает о курсе по тестированию игр: как выбрать формат, где найти мотивированных студентов и как вырастить из них будущих специалистов.

Цель: найти стажеров-тестировщиков


Компания Mail.Ru Group тестирует игровые проекты в Воронеже уже более десяти лет — это Warface, Аллоды Онлайн, Hawk, SkyForge и другие. С числом проектов увеличивается и потребность в квалифицированных кадрах: сейчас тестированием 12 проектов занимаются около 70 человек. Все проекты — высокобюджетные массовые игры, собирающие более миллиона зарегистрированных пользователей в неделю. Работа над ними требует глубоких знаний и понимания игровых процессов, поэтому потребность в специалистах существует постоянно.

В воронежском подразделении Mail.Ru Group есть четкое представление о том, каким должен быть идеальный кандидат:

  • отличные технические навыки,
  • логическая база,
  • проактивный,
  • внимательный к деталям,
  • с хорошим пониманием игрового рынка,
  • с игровым опытом.

Подходящих специалистов на воронежском рынке труда мало, перспективных ребят из вузов уводят другие IT-компании Воронежа. Поэтому было принято решение готовить специалистов под себя: разработать курсы по модели уже существующих образовательных проектов Mail.Ru Group. Компания сотрудничает с пятью ведущими вузами Москвы и Санкт-Петербурга («Технопарк» в МГТУ им. Н. Э. Баумана, «Техносфера» в МГУ, «Технотрек» в МФТИ, «Техноатом» в МИФИ и «Технополис» в СПбПУ) и готовит специалистов, исходя из своих потребностей. Образовательная и стажерская программы реализуются уже 7 лет, и ежегодно в различные проекты компании выходит порядка 150 новых стажеров.

Решение: запустить образовательный курс по тестированию


В качестве базы для запуска курса был выбран Воронежский Государственный Университет — крупнейший вуз Черноземья, который в этом году отмечает 100-летний юбилей. В ВГУ учится около 20 000 студентов.

С апреля по июнь 2018 года в ВГУ был проведен пилотный запуск курса по тестированию игр. Он проводился в формате интенсива — краткого курса из 8 занятий, в ходе которого студенты получили большой объем теории, одновременно делая упор на практическую разработку.

Интенсив состоял из восьми лекций. Преподаватели стремились дать студентам как можно больше практики: на примере реальных проектов показывали внутренние процессы, разбирали рабочие ситуации, рассказывали, какие навыки требовались для их решения. Программа составлялась таким образом, чтобы показать всю многогранность профессии тестировщика, сломать стереотип о том, что тестирование игр — скучная и низкооплачиваемая работа, и показать ребятам, что эта специальность может быть не только интересной, но и выгодной с точки зрения заработка.

Еще одна задача, которую предстояло решить в ходе курса, — адаптация потенциальных стажеров уже в процессе обучения. Для этого преподаватели знакомили студентов с инструментарием и бизнес-процессами, принятыми в компании, а также с корпоративной культурой Mail.Ru Group.

Пилотный запуск подтвердил эффективность подбора и подготовки стажеров: из 28 студентов, завершивших курс, 15 были приглашены на собеседование, шестерых взяли на позиции стажеров-тестировщиков и еще троих — на другие вакансии.

Результаты пилотного курса




Основной аудиторией интенсива были учащиеся факультета прикладной математики, информатики и механики, факультета компьютерных наук, а также студенты из других вузов преимущественно 2-го, 3-го и 4-го курсов. По итогам интенсива было принято решение запустить полноценный образовательный проект с семестровыми курсами по специальностям «Тестирование игровых проектов» и «Разработка игр на Unity».

«Игросфера»: отбор и обучение


Отбор на курс «Тестирование игровых проектов» включал вопросы на мотивацию (заинтересованность, готовность участвовать в стажировке), а также вопросы, направленные на выявление игрового опыта: студентов просили описать, в какие игры и как долго они играют, какие предпочитают жанры, имеют ли опыт бета-тестирования и т.д. Кроме того, кандидатам предлагалась техническая задача: написать сценарий тестирования DLC (дополнительного контента для игр), указать, какие моменты нужно проверить перед отдачей дополнения игрокам.

На курс по тестированию игровых проектов было подано 170 заявок, на курс по Unity — 222. По результатам тестирования обучение начали 70 студентов: по 35 человек по каждому направлению.

Курс «Тестирование игровых проектов» состоит из 16 лекций (44 академических часа), которые охватывают различные направления тестирования: консольное, мобильное и другие. Кроме того, предусмотрено 5 домашних заданий и около 60 часов самостоятельной работы.

Программа курса:

  1. Введение в тестирование
  2. Основной процесс тестирования. Место тестирования в жизненном цикле ПО
  3. Методы проектирования тестов
  4. Управление тестированием
  5. Базовый инструментарий тестировщика
  6. Тестирование звуков в играх: SFX, музыка, диалоги
  7. Инструментальные средства поддержки
  8. Инструменты автоматизации тестирования
  9. Автоматизация процессов тестирования на примере проекта«Аллоды Онлайн»
  10. Визуальная составляющая игр
  11. Игровые движки. Особенности, проблемы
  12. Особенности тестирования интерфейса
  13. Особенности тестирования консольных приложений
  14. Особенности тестирования мобильных приложений
  15. Процессы работы с фичами на проекте «Аллоды Онлайн»
  16. Рубежный контроль. Итоговый тест на знание основ тестирования

В рамках учебной программы идут не только лекционные занятия, но и практические семинары, которые подразумевают составление тест-кейсов и планов проверок по пройденному материалу. Например, студенты изучают тестирование визуальных материалов, а затем на основе полученных знаний тестируют готовые шаблоны.

Коммуникация не ограничивается лекциями и практическими работами: есть неформальные чаты, в которых преподаватели отвечают на любые вопросы и помогают с домашними заданиями. На сайте проекта ребята могут оставить свои отзывы о проведенных лекциях.


Скриншот внутренней части портала «Игросферы»

Обучение стартовало 20 сентября, а 6 сентября прошел День открытых дверей «Игросферы»: студенты познакомились с преподавателями, узнали о программах обучения и задали вопросы о проекте. Запись трансляции доступна в группе «Игросферы» Вконтакте.

«Игросфера»: взгляд в будущее


В такой динамичной сфере, как игровая индустрия, нельзя стоять на месте и из года в год читать слушателям курсов один и тот же материал. Уже в следующем семестре планируется увеличить число курсов и лекций. Игровая специализация тестировщиков была выбрана исходя из потребностей Mail.Ru Group на текущий момент, но компания растет, и спектр задач расширяется. Одно из направлений развития — мобильное тестирование. Также планируется разделить курсы, например, отдельно преподавать тестирование игр для консоли и мобильных игр.



Так или иначе, запуск подобных курсов — отличный позитивный опыт для компании и возможность получить знания и навыки от практикующих профессионалов для студентов.

Комментарии (0)